About the Company
Heritage Lifecare is a reputable aged care provider, supporting over 2,500 individuals through residential aged care services and care homes across New Zealand. We are dedicated to fostering environments that feel like home, emphasizing inclusion, interaction, and strong community values. Colwyn House Lifecare, located in the sunny Hawke's Bay town of Hastings, is a 69-bed care home specializing in Dementia and Psychogeriatric Care.
